About Nova Independent School
Nova Independent School is a small learning community in west Ottawa focused on curiosity, creativity, and meaningful connection. We offer a thoughtful environment where children ages 5–12 are encouraged to think independently, collaborate with others, and engage deeply with hands-on learning experiences.
In addition to full time enrollment, Nova also welcomes part-time learners and homeschooling families who join our community one to three days a week to complement their home programs.
